CENTRE FOR RESEARCH IN INTEGRATED CARE
The Centre for Research in Integrated Care (CRIC) is based out of UNB Saint John. CRIC is a living laboratory that develops and evaluates integrated patient-centred models of care for individuals with complex care needs, their families, and members of the care team.

YOUR FOCUS

Reporting to the Research Program Manager, the Research and Network Coordinator will work closely with the centre's Director, Associate Director and Research Program Manager to establish a provincial practice-based research and learning network (PBRLN) in New Brunswick that connects primary care clinics to support shared learning, quality improvement, and health services research. The successful candidate will also design, lead and conduct a large-scale research project on the implementation of the network in the province.

  • Build, strengthen, and maintain strategic relationships with clinicians, policy-makers, community members, indigenous partners, and data managers across the province.
  • Coordinate multiple data-sharing and transfer agreements and ensure compliance with ethical, privacy, and regulatory requirements.
  • Travel throughout New Brunswick to engage and support rural and geographically remote clinic partners.
  • Design a logic model, prepare a research protocol, and prepare research ethics applications.
  • Initiate, design, and lead a comprehensive evaluation of the development of the network.
  • Design surveys and interview questionnaires, manage data collection, conduct data analysis, and present results.
  • Supervise and delegate research staff work to support the evaluation and develop and deliver training to both research staff and support staff as required.
  • Manage and oversee project activities, define roles and timelines, monitor progress, and provide guidance to research and administrative staff.
  • Identify and secure public and private funding to support network sustainability and growth.
  • Prepare and submit grant applications and manage associated timelines and reporting requirements.
  • Secure funding to support participating clinics, including compensation, cost offsets, and engagement incentives.
  • Oversee and lead knowledge translation activities.
  • Present findings to interest-holders through presentations, policy briefs, and reports, and contribute to research publications.
  • Co-author scientific manuscripts for academic publication and prepare reports as required.
